通过对海上作战环境的特点和要求的介绍,对舰船无源干扰系统的干扰方式由简单到复杂的发展分析.提出未来舰船无源干扰系统的作战体系正朝着综合一体化、网络中心战、辅助舰船自卫的干扰无人机方向发展,推进装备系统的通用化、标准化、模块化.
Based on the limits of existing near-infrared camouflage detection equipments in the field, the spectral difference between natural green and artificial green was analyzed. Combined with examination principle of green light microscope, the narrow band-pass filter near-infrared camouflage detection method under the conditions of in the field was mentioned, the detection effect was Verified, and the effect on its military applications was certified.
